Joey Chestnut Wins Nathan's Hot Dog Contest in Coney Island

The #1-ranked eater in the world Joey Chestnut closes his eyes while waiting for the belt ceremony after winning the 104th Nathan's Famous Fourth of July International Hot Dog Eating Contest with a record total of 75 hot dogs and buns on July 4, 2020 in New York City. The Nathan's Famous Fourth of July International Hot Dog Eating Contest has occurred each July 4th in Coney Island since 1916. This years competition was held at an undisclosed location in an attempt to control crowds due to the Coronavirus pandemic. Photo by John Angelillo/UPI
